Call for Papers Deadline: 01 Oct 2026

NJCA Call for Papers: Next-Generation Anatomy Education

The National Journal of Clinical Anatomy announces a special issue focused on digital innovation, clinical integration, simulation, AI, and future-ready anatomy education.

The National Journal of Clinical Anatomy has announced a special issue on Next-Generation Anatomy Education, highlighting the evolving role of technology, clinical practice, and innovation in anatomical sciences. Suggested themes include artificial intelligence, virtual and augmented reality, competency-based anatomy education, radiological and surgical anatomy integration, cadaveric dissection ethics, assessment strategies, 3D printing, anatomical modeling, and faculty development. Original research, reviews, short communications, educational innovations, and perspectives are invited.
